Rafael Caparica
About
Rafael Caparica is a scholar working on Oncology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Cancer Research.
According to data from OpenAlex, Rafael Caparica has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 505 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Oncology, 17 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 8 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Rafael Caparica’s work include Advanced Breast Cancer Therapies (9 papers), H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(9 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(8 papers). Rafael Caparica is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Breast Cancer Therapies (9 papers), H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(9 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(8 papers). Rafael Caparica coll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, Italy and Brazil. Rafael Caparica's co-authors include Evandro de Azambuja, Mariana Brandão, Martine Piccart, Marcello Ceppi and Matteo Lambertini and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, JNCI Journal of the National Cancer Institute and Cancer Research.
